如何在可视化平台展示中实现数据可视化散点图?

在当今数据驱动的世界中,数据可视化已经成为展示和分析数据的重要工具。其中,散点图作为一种常用的数据可视化形式,能够有效地展示数据之间的关系。本文将详细介绍如何在可视化平台中实现数据可视化散点图,帮助您更好地理解和运用这一工具。

一、散点图的基本概念

1. 散点图定义

散点图(Scatter Plot)是一种用二维坐标表示数据点的图表,其中横轴和纵轴分别代表两个不同的变量。通过散点图,我们可以直观地观察两个变量之间的关系,包括正相关、负相关和无相关。

2. 散点图的特点

  • 直观性:散点图能够直观地展示数据之间的关系,便于观察者快速获取信息。
  • 灵活性:散点图可以展示多个变量之间的关系,且可以根据需要调整横轴和纵轴的刻度。
  • 可交互性:一些可视化平台支持散点图的交互功能,如放大、缩小、筛选等,便于观察者深入分析数据。

二、可视化平台实现散点图

1. 选择合适的可视化平台

目前,市面上有很多可视化平台可供选择,如Tableau、Power BI、ECharts等。在选择平台时,需要考虑以下因素:

  • 易用性:平台是否易于上手,是否有丰富的教程和社区支持。
  • 功能丰富性:平台是否支持多种图表类型、数据导入、导出等功能。
  • 性能:平台在处理大量数据时的性能如何。

2. 数据准备

在可视化平台中创建散点图之前,需要先准备好数据。数据来源可以是Excel、CSV、数据库等。以下是一些数据准备的建议:

  • 数据清洗:删除重复数据、处理缺失值、修正错误等。
  • 数据转换:根据需要将数据转换为合适的格式,如将字符串转换为数值。
  • 数据关联:将不同数据源中的数据关联起来,以便在散点图中展示。

3. 创建散点图

以下以ECharts为例,介绍如何在可视化平台中创建散点图:

(1)在ECharts中创建一个图表实例:

var myChart = echarts.init(document.getElementById('main'));

(2)设置图表的配置项和数据:

var option = {
title: {
text: '散点图示例'
},
tooltip: {},
xAxis: {
data: ["A", "B", "C", "D", "E"]
},
yAxis: {},
series: [{
name: '销量',
type: 'scatter',
data: [[10, 20], [20, 30], [30, 40], [40, 50], [50, 60]]
}]
};

(3)使用刚指定的配置项和数据显示图表:

myChart.setOption(option);

4. 散点图美化

为了使散点图更加美观,可以调整以下参数:

  • 颜色:为散点设置不同的颜色,以便区分不同的数据类别。
  • 大小:根据数据的重要性调整散点的大小。
  • 形状:使用不同的形状表示不同的数据类别。

三、案例分析

以下是一个使用散点图展示销售额与广告费用的案例:

(1)数据准备:

广告费用(万元) 销售额(万元)
10 20
20 30
30 40
40 50
50 60

(2)创建散点图:

根据上述数据,使用ECharts创建散点图,并设置横轴为广告费用,纵轴为销售额。在散点图上,我们可以观察到销售额与广告费用之间存在正相关关系。

四、总结

本文介绍了如何在可视化平台中实现数据可视化散点图,包括散点图的基本概念、可视化平台选择、数据准备、创建散点图以及散点图美化等方面。通过学习本文,您将能够更好地运用散点图这一工具,直观地展示和分析数据之间的关系。

猜你喜欢:零侵扰可观测性